This video features a legal analysis of a convenience store robbery where the clerk pursued and shot one of the fleeing suspects. The analysis emphasizes the significant legal risks associated with engaging in 'optional gunfights,' even when justified by initial self-defense. It highlights that while the clerk may not face charges, the emotional, social, and potential legal consequences of taking a life, even in defense, are substantial and often avoidable by securing the scene and contacting law enforcement.
This entry analyzes an incident where an off-duty officer engaged fleeing robbers. Expert John Correia, an Evidence-Based Defensive Trainer, breaks down the tactical decisions, emphasizing the risks of initiating an 'optional gunfight' by chasing suspects. The analysis highlights the importance of waiting for a tactical advantage and maintaining marksmanship under stress.
